The W3051E Electro-Thermal Dynamic Model Generator computes and generates dynamic (transient) electrothermal (ETH) models for reuse in ADS. It also speeds up dynamic Electro-Thermal Simulation by 20x to as much as over 400x depending on the complexity of the input signal modulation and circuit simulator required to analyze it.

The W3051E is integrated within ADS for closed-loop dynamic circuit-electrothermal cosimulation when used together with Circuit-Envelope or Transient-Convolution circuit simulators in ADS. The generated dynamic ETH model can also be used for steady-state electrothermal simulation with the linear or harmonic balance circuit simulators.

The W3051E also supports dynamic electrothermal simulation across multi-technology (IC,-package-laminate-PCB) boundaries.
